
A Hopfield network is a form of recurrent artificial neural network invented by John Hopfield in 1982. Hopfield nets serve as content-addressable memory systems with binary threshold nodes. A type of feedback neural network that is often used as an associative memory or as a solution to a combinatorial optimization problem.
